Dit hier is een zeer geavanceerde 24u temperatuur logger, die de temperatuur elke 15 seconden registreert en dan het gemiddelden over 1 min en 12mins. De waarde 12min gemiddeld wordt uitgezet op de tijdlijn op een OLED scherm van 128 x 64. Het gemiddelde 1min wordt afgedrukt op de bodem juiste hoek van het scherm.
Het apparaat heeft een real-time klok en de tijd op de bodem verlaten hoek van het scherm wordt weergegeven. Volgens de lengte- en breedtegraad, het apparaat berekent zonsondergang en het plots op midden onder in het scherm.
De gebruiker kan een wake-up tijd waartegen het apparaat begint te langzaam draaien op lightbulbs daarop instellen. Dit gebeurt alleen als de echte zonsondergang hoger dan is of minder dan 30 minuten eerder dan de ingestelde tijd wakker.
De Code van de Arduino voor het apparaat wordt vermeld in stap 3. Het biedt een heleboel opties om het apparaat voor uw behoeften af te stemmen.
De video toont het apparaat tijdens het opstarten van en het testen van de lichten. In de ochtend duurt de totale sequentie van het licht-up 30 minuten.
Ingrediënten
- Een Arduino board (ik gebruik een Nano)
- 128 x 64 SSD1306 OLED-display voor Arduino
- DS3231 real timerklok voor Arduino
- Een 8 output relais boord voor Arduino
- DHT22 temperatuursensor voor Arduino
- 9V 0.5A adapter voor Arduino
- Lm7805 regelaar
- Een IKEA Pluggis-box
- 8 lampen en hun kassen
- Sommige jumper kabels
- Sommige stroomkabels
- Een PC met USB
- Basiskennis en gruis programma Arduino en aan te pakken problemen
- KENNIS OP DE NETVOEDING MUUR HANDVAT